Maxine Peake play for Lowry

Published: 19 October 2015
Reporter: David Upton

Beryl

West Yorkshire Playhouse is currently touring Maxine Peake’s stage play Beryl, based on her radio play about Beryl Burton, the champion cyclist.

The show premièred in Leeds in 2014 but this tour has two versions (same cast, two sets) one of which is doing one-night stands on a rural touring scheme and the larger version is touring to middle-scale theatres—including the Quays at The Lowry.

Beryl is at The Lowry November 2-4.

Peake’s play celebrates the life of unsung sporting legend Beryl Burton—the greatest woman on two wheels.

With husband, daughter and cycling club at her side, she became five-times world pursuit champion, 13-times national pursuit champion, twice road-racing world champion and still made it home in time for dinner.
